انیمیشن در ویژوال پارادایم
آموزش انیمیشن در نرم افزار ویژوال پارادایم را در eBPM یاد بگیرید. در ادامه در مورد مراحل انیمیشن سازی در نرم افزار ویژوال پارادایم صحبت خواهیم کرد.
ویژوال پارادایم (Visual Paradigm) یک نرمافزار جامع برای مدلسازی، طراحی، مستندسازی فرایند و مدیریت سیستمهای نرمافزاری و فرآیندهای سازمانی است. این نرمافزار به افراد و سازمانها کمک میکند تا ایدهها، فرآیندها و ساختارهای مختلف را بهصورت بصری نمایش دهند و تحلیل کنند.
تصور کنید که میخواهید یک سیستم نرمافزاری را طراحی کنید یا نحوه عملکرد یک سازمان را تحلیل کنید؛ ویژوال پارادایم به شما این امکان را میدهد که این اطلاعات را به شکل نمودارهای گرافیکی نمایش دهید تا درک آنها آسانتر شود.
نقش انیمیشن در مدلسازی و تحلیل سیستم ها
یکی از ویژگیهای قدرتمند ویژوال پارادایم، انیمیشنسازی مدلها است که به کاربران اجازه میدهد تا جریان فرآیندها و رفتار سیستمها را بهصورت تصویری و تعاملی مشاهده کنند. این قابلیت به ویژه در تحلیل، آموزش و ارائه مدلهای پیچیده بسیار مفید است.
حالا سوالی که مطرح میشود این است که چرا انیمیشنسازی در ویژوال پارادایم استفاده میشود و در مدلسازی فرایند مهم است؟
- نمایش پویا و دقیقتر فرآیندها
انیمیشنها به جای ارائه دادهها یا مدلها به صورت ایستا (مانند نمودارهای ثابت)، فرآیندها و تعاملات را بهصورت پویا و متحرک نشان میدهند. این نمایش پویا به وضوح و دقت بیشتری، درک فرآیندها و سیستمها را ممکن میسازد.
- بهبود تجسم و درک سیستمهای پیچیده
سیستمهای پیچیده شامل چندین ورودی، خروجی، تعامل و فرآیند هستند که برای درک بهتر نیاز به یک نمایش بصری جامع دارند. انیمیشنها میتوانند پیچیدگیها را ساده کنند و به وضوح نشان دهند که چگونه بخشهای مختلف سیستم با یکدیگر تعامل دارند. این امر بهویژه برای افراد جدید و کسانی که با سیستم آشنایی ندارند، مفید است.
- کمک به شبیهسازی و آزمایش سناریوها
انیمیشنسازی در ویژوال پارادایم به کاربران این امکان را میدهد که سناریوهای مختلف را شبیهسازی کنند و مشاهده کنند که سیستم یا فرآیند چگونه در شرایط مختلف عمل میکند. این ویژگی به تحلیلگران و طراحان این امکان را میدهد که مشکلات یا فرصتهای بهبود را قبل از پیادهسازی واقعی شبیهسازی کنند.
- افزایش تعامل و درک بهتر توسط کاربران
در فرآیندهای آموزشی یا وقتی که تیمهای مختلف در حال همکاری هستند، انیمیشنها میتوانند تعاملات بهتری را ایجاد کنند. با مشاهده انیمیشنهای مدلسازی شده، افراد میتوانند درک بهتری از نحوه عملکرد بخشهای مختلف سیستم یا فرآیند پیدا کنند.
- تسهیل ارتباط و مستندسازی
انیمیشنها میتوانند بهعنوان ابزار مستندسازی بصری برای تیمها و سازمانها عمل کنند. این مستندات میتوانند بهراحتی به اشتراک گذاشته شوند و به تمام اعضای تیم کمک کنند تا فرآیندها، سیستمها یا معماریها را بهصورت یکسان و قابلفهم مشاهده کنند. این امر به ویژه در پروژههای بزرگ و تیمهای چندمنظوره اهمیت دارد.
چگونه انیمیشنسازی در ویژوال پارادایم به فهم فرآیندها کمک میکند؟
انیمیشنسازی در ویژوال پارادایم بهطور ویژه برای افزایش درک و فهم فرآیندها و سیستمها طراحی شده است. در اینجا چند روش کلیدی که انیمیشنسازی میتواند به فهم بهتر فرآیندها کمک کند آورده شده است:
- توضیح مرحله به مرحله فرآیندها
انیمیشنها بهطور گامبهگام و پیوسته فرآیندها را نمایش میدهند. این نوع نمایش باعث میشود که مراحل مختلف یک فرآیند یا تعاملات پیچیده بهصورت خطی و متوالی نشان داده شوند و بیننده بتواند به راحتی نحوه حرکت از یک مرحله به مرحله بعدی را درک کند.
- کمک به درک جریانهای اطلاعاتی
انیمیشنها میتوانند حرکت اطلاعات و دادهها را در یک سیستم یا فرآیند نشان دهند. این امکان به کاربران میدهد که دریابند که دادهها از کجا میآیند، چگونه پردازش میشوند و به کجا میروند. به این ترتیب، کاربران میتوانند بهتر درک کنند که چگونه هر بخش از سیستم به یکدیگر متصل است.
مثال: در یک سیستم اطلاعاتی مدیریت مشتریان، انیمیشن میتواند نشان دهد که چگونه اطلاعات مشتری از مرحله ثبت به مرحله پردازش و ذخیرهسازی میرود.
- آسانتر شدن تست و عیبیابی سیستمها
انیمیشنها میتوانند بهطور مؤثر به شبیهسازی مشکلات یا خطاهای احتمالی کمک کنند. این شبیهسازی به طراحان و تحلیلگران این امکان را میدهد که درک بهتری از نحوه وقوع مشکلات پیدا کنند و به راحتی آنها را شبیهسازی و آزمایش کنند.
مثال: در طراحی یک سیستم نرمافزاری، اگر مشکلی در تعامل بین دو بخش مختلف سیستم وجود داشته باشد، انیمیشن میتواند به طور دقیق نشان دهد که چگونه این تعاملات به خطا منجر میشود.
- تفاوت بین انیمیشن و شبیهسازی در ویژوال پارادایم
ویژوال پارادایم علاوه بر انیمیشن، امکان شبیهسازی فرآیندها را نیز فراهم میکند، اما این دو مفهوم تفاوتهایی دارند:
ویژوال پارادایم یک ابزار قدرتمند برای مدلسازی و مستندسازی سیستمهای نرمافزاری و کسبوکاری است. قابلیت انیمیشنسازی آن امکان توضیح بهتر مدلها، تجسم فرآیندها و شبیهسازی جریانها را فراهم میکند. این ویژگی به تحلیلگران، توسعهدهندگان، و مدیران کمک میکند تا تصمیمات بهتری در طراحی و پیادهسازی سیستمها بگیرند.
- ابزارهای انیمیشن در ویژوال پارادایم
ویژوال پارادایم مجموعهای از ابزارهای انیمیشنسازی ارائه میدهد که امکان ایجاد، تنظیم، اجرا و ویرایش انیمیشنها را فراهم میکنند.
پنل انیمیشن (Animation Panel)
Animation Panel بخش اصلی برای مدیریت و اجرای انیمیشنها است. امکانات آن شامل:
- افزودن، ویرایش و حذف فریمهای انیمیشن
- تنظیم ترتیب و زمانبندی نمایش عناصر
- تغییر سرعت اجرا و تنظیم نقاط توقف
خط زمانی (Timeline)
خط زمانی (Timeline) برای کنترل توالی و زمان اجرای رویدادها در انیمیشن استفاده میشود. امکانات آن:
- افزودن فریمهای کلیدی (Keyframes)
- تنظیم زمانبندی و تأخیر بین فریمها
- کنترل سرعت اجرای انیمیشن
کنترلهای پخش انیمیشن (Playback Controls)
این ابزار به کاربر اجازه میدهد تا انیمیشن را اجرا، مکث یا بازبینی کند. شامل:
▶ Play: اجرای انیمیشن
⏸ Pause: توقف موقت
⏮ Rewind: بازگشت به ابتدا
تنظیمات نمایش انیمیشن (Animation Settings)
در این بخش، میتوان موارد زیر را تنظیم کرد:
- تنظیمات رنگ و شفافیت عناصر متحرک
- نحوه ورود و خروج اشیا (Fade-in, Fade-out)
- امکان کنترل نمایش المانها در حالت پلهپله (Step-by-Step)
- مراحل ایجاد انیمیشن در ویژوال پارادایم
ابتدا برای انیمیشن سازی فرایند با ویژوال پارادایم” فرایند درخواست نامنظم” را که از قبل مدلسازی شده است را در نظر میگیریم:
– کارشناس، درخواست ملزومات درخواست کننده را ثبت نموده و برای مسئول مافوق خود ارسال مینماید.
– مقام مافوق پس از بررسی درخواست، درصورت نیاز به اصلاح برای کارشناس ارسال مینماید
– درصورت عدم تایید نتیجه را برای کارشناس و درنتیجه درخواست کننده ارسال می نمایند.
– درصورت تایید هم کارشناس حواله و فاکتور را ایجاد میکند و کار برای انباردار میرود تا بسته بندی کند و برای مشتری ارسال کند.
برای انیمیشن سازی فرایند، فرایند ساده ای را مدلسازی کرده ایم. از آنجایی که در جریان مدلسازی فرایند ها هستید، سراغ اصل مطلب یعنی انمیشن سازی فرایند میرویم.
انیمیشن شامل چندین کاربرد است، در ابتدا به فهم بهتر فرایند و پی بردن به مسیر های ممکن موجود در فرایند کمک میکند و در ثانی هرگاه بخواهید برای مدیران ارشد فرایند خود را ارائه دهید، از ابتدا تا انتهای مسیر را میتوانید با استفاده از انیمیشن تصویرسازی کنید.
همچنین بعضی اوقات یک سری از تسکها نیازمند توضیحات اضافه ای هستند که باید به صورت شفاهی بیان شود به همین منظور میتوان از قبل این موارد را به صورت فایل صوتی ضبط کرده و زمانی که انیمیشن اجرا و به تسک مدنظر نزدیک میشود، به طور خودکار فایل صوتی پخش شود.
حالا میتوان از دو مسیر فرایند را انیمیشن سازی کرد:
وقتی در صفحه هستید، در قسمت سفید صفحه کلیک راست کنید و گزینه show Animation panel را انتخاب کنید و به همین ترتیب پنل برای شما باز میشود.
راه دوم این است که در نوار بالا، منو Modeling را انتخاب کرده و گزینه Animation را میزنید.
برای ایجاد مسیر انیمیشین، روی علامت مثبت کلیک کرده و نام فرایند را مینویسید.
حالا با انتخاب نام مسیر و اجرا کردن انیمیشن، اجرا تا جایی ادامه میابد که نیازمند تصمیمی گیری نباشد. پس در نتیجه هرجا گیت وی(گیت وی ها یا از نوع XOR یا ORباید باشند) وجود داشته باشد، متوقف میشود و در پنل از شما میپرسد که از کدام مسیر برود.
بعد از انتخاب مسیر در هر گیت وی، انیمیشن مسیر خود را ادامه میدهد. اگر در مسیر نقطه تصمیمی گیری دیگری وجود نداشته باشد، به پایان فرایند میرسد.
حالا اگر بخواهید علاوه بر مسیر قبل، مسیر جدیدی اضافه کنید و همه مسیر های ممکن را بررسی نمایید، مانند قبل علامت مثبت را انتخاب کرده و نام فرایند دوم را درج میکنید.
به همین منوال، تمامی مسیر های مورد نظر خود را میتوانید استخراج کنید.
این بار نام فرایند را عدم تایید میگذاریم و در توقف گیت وی، مسیر عدم تایید را انتخاب و انیمیشن را اجرا میکنیم.
در این قسمت مقاله میخواهیم در مورد تفاوت نوع گیت وی های هر فرایند هنگام اجرا کردن انیمیشن، صحبت کنیم.
نکته ای که وجود دارد این است که:
- اگر گیت وی از نوع XOR بود، فقط میتوان یکی از گزینهها یا مسیر ها را انتخاب کرد.(مثال در بخش های قبلی)
- اگر گیت وی از نوع Paralel بود اجرا متوقف نمیشود و همه حالات با هم در نظر گرفته میشود.
- اگر گیت وی از نوع OR بود، گزینهها به شکل چک لیست ظاهر میشود یعنی میتوان یکی ازآنها یا ترکیبی از آنها را انتخاب کنید.
در پنل انیمیشن، گزینه ای تحت عنوان Option وجود دارد که وقتی روی آن میزنید، پنجره Animation Option باز میشود و میتوان تنظیماتی مثل تعیین رنگ و پخش صدا را ایجاد کرد یا تغییر داد.
گزینه Play voice نشان دهنده این است که هر صدای ضبط شده ای به صورت خودکار اجرا میشود.
برای تغییر رنگ وارد تب Advanced میشوید و تغییرات مورد نظر را اعمال میکنید.
در نهایت برای خروجی گرفتن به صورت html روی Export میزنید و با انتخاب آدرس مسیر فرایند در سیستم، تایید را میزنید.
نرم افزار ویژوال پارادایم از انواع مختلفی از نمودارهای مدلسازی برای نمایش سیستمها، فرآیندها و دادهها پشتیبانی میکند. انیمیشنسازی در این نرمافزار به کمک این نمودارها میآید تا تعاملات و فرآیندهای پیچیده بهصورت بصری و زنده نمایش داده شوند. این ویژگی نه تنها باعث درک بهتر سیستمها و فرآیندها میشود، بلکه به شبیهسازی، آموزش و تحلیلهای پیچیده نیز کمک میکند.